Abstract:
A system for improving carbonation in post-mix beverage dispenser carbonators, including the method of automatically venting the headspace in a carbonator tank to atmosphere at predetermined times and for a predetermined length of time. This system eliminates most of the air from the headspace and provides a significant improvement in carbonating efficiency, in-line carbonation and in cup carbonation.

Abstract:
A beverage brewing apparatus for use in vending machines has an open top and open bottom cylinder that is vertically movably supported by a frame on rods. A piston is also vertically movably supported by the rods and is normally pushed upwardly by coil springs disposed surrounding the rods. Bias springs are disposed between the frame and cylinder to push the cylinder dowardly whereby the sealing situation between the cylinder and brewing cavity is assured during progress of the brewing operation within the apparatus.
Abstract:
A manually-refillable water reservoir assembly, which may be retrofit to a post-mix beverage dispenser to supply water from the reservoir instead of from a commercial water supply, includes a manually-refillable water container which plugs into a base assembly. The base assembly includes a socket for receiving the container, a centrifugal pump and a water filter. The beverage dispenser contains a turbine-type pump for supplying water to a carbonator at a predetermined pressure and flow rate. The inherent slippage in the centrifugal pump permits the flow rate and pressure of water supplied to the dispenser to adjust to that of the turbine-type pump.
Abstract:
Beverage brewing apparatus suitable for use in a vending machine has a frame supporting a vertically movable open bottom cylinder and a piston slidably disposed within the cylinder. A brewing cavity is disposed beneath the cylinder to enable reciprocation horizontally between a brewing position and a rest position. The horizontal movement of the cavity is controlled through a cable running around a pulley rotatably supported on the frame. The pulley is provided with a mechanism for adjusting the position thereof to determine the brewing position and rest position of the cavity to ensure secure engagement between the cylinder and brewing cavity.
Abstract:
A dual temperature beverage dispenser for providing a variety of beverages, both hot and cool from a small, high capacity, coin-activated unit. The dispenser includes a removable operating module which can be stored for safekeeping separate and apart from a water storage unit which becomes inoperative when the operating module is removed. The water storage unit includes a hot water heater including a tank and a storage tank for ambient water oriented above the hot water heater tank for gravity flow of ambient water to the hot water heater tank when required and for gravity flow to a discharge point in the operating module to enable ambient or cool water to be obtained without payment or beverage to be obtained from the dispenser by use of an appropriate coin or token. The water discharge assembly includes a screen in a projecting nipple which automatically couples and uncouples with the operating module when it is installed on or removed from the water storage unit to prevent drippage when the operating module is removed and also the operating module includes a coin control and rejection system to assure proper payment for a beverage dispensed from the dispenser.
Abstract:
A beverage brewing apparatus suitable for use in a vending machine has a frame supporting a vertically movable open-bottom cylinder and a piston slidably disposed within the cylinder. A base assembly is reciprocal horizontally between a brewing position and rest position. Actuation of various components is controlled by a motor through a cam shaft. The downward movement of the piston is controlled by the operation of a cam element, but this operation of the cam applying vertical force to push the piston also applies a horizontal force tending to offset the axial center lines between the piston and cylinder. Therefore means for preventing the piston from lateral horizontal movement relative to the cylinder insures improved sealing between the piston and cylinder.
Abstract:
A dispensing apparatus for dispensing discrete measured amounts of fluent material. A dispenser body includes a horizontal tubular chamber having an upper inlet port and a lower outlet port in communication with the tubular chamber. A reservoir communicates with the inlet port. A piston having a plurality of vertical and horizontal measuring holes is disposed within the horizontal tubular chamber and configured for rotational and reciprocal linear sliding engagement with the tubular chamber and each of the measuring holes can alternatively communicate with the inlet port and the outlet port when so aligned. The amount of fluent material dispensed is determined by the volume of the measuring hole. Another embodiment involves measuring holes open at one end only, with the piston rotatable to alternatively communicate the measuring hole with the inlet port and the outlet port.
